Abstract

In one embodiment, a compliant contactor is provided which includes a center conductor and an outer conductor with a spacer therebetween. The outer conductor has a mating end adapted to be capable of flexibly contacting an outer conductor mating surface prior to the center conductor contacting a center conductor mating surface.

Claims (30)

1. An axial cable configured to contact a receiving structure, the axial cable comprising:

a) a first conductor generally axially aligned with the axial cable and configured to contact the receiving structure at a first conductor end, wherein the first conductor is non-compliant;

b) a second conductor disposed about the first conductor;

c) a second conductor contactor positioned about the first conductor and secured to an end of the axial cable, wherein the second conductor contactor is configured to contact the receiving structure at a second conductor contactor end, wherein the second conductor contactor end is positioned to contact the receiving structure prior to the first conductor end contacting the receiving structure as the axial cable contacts the receiving structure, and wherein the second conductor contactor is compliant to allow the first conductor end to contact the receiving structure;

d) a spacer positioned between the first conductor and the second conductor contactor; and

e) wherein the second conductor contactor has a central axis aligned with a central axis of the axial cable, and wherein the second conductor contactor electrically contacts the second conductor.

2. The axial cable of claim 1 , wherein the first conductor is configured to carry a signal and the second conductor is configured to be at least one of (a) a return for the signal; or (b) a ground.

3. The axial cable of claim 1 , wherein the spacer comprises at least one of: (1) an insulator; (2) a non-conductor; (3) a semi-conductor; or (4) an ESD material.

4. The axial cable of claim 1 , wherein the first conductor, the second conductor, and the spacer are at least one of: (1) concentric; and (2) coaxial.

5. The axial cable of claim 1 , wherein the second conductor contactor comprises a deformable member.

6. The axial cable of claim 1 , wherein the second conductor contactor is substantially cylindrical.

7. The axial cable of claim 1 , wherein the axial cable has a length, and wherein the axial cable has a substantially constant impedance along the length.

8. The axial cable of claim 1 , wherein the second conductor contactor is removable.
